Transaction 08fdad72532bd144804006639448b77020c25ce6efefca21acdca9020a6a73b3

1 Input
2 Outputs
  • 08fdad72532bd144804006639448b77020c25ce6efefca21acdca9020a6a73b3:0
  • value  88701198
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F
  • 08fdad72532bd144804006639448b77020c25ce6efefca21acdca9020a6a73b3:1
  • value  30000000
    address  1Hq6HhHB5zAqDR1TDPpA2kRHiYp3pYUFK